Distance From Thunder Bay Airport to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(YQT - AUS Distance)

The flight distance from Thunder Bay Airport (YQT) to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) is 1331 miles. This is equivalent to 2142 kilometers or 1156 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.


2142 kilometers is the distance from Thunder Bay Airport, Canada to Austin-Bergstrom International Airport, United States.


Flight Duration between Thunder Bay, Canada and Austin, United States

Estimated flight time from Thunder Bay Airport, Thunder Bay, Canada to Austin-Bergstrom International Airport, Austin, United States is 2 hours 39 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
